This place has been around for a LONG time and it's no wonder. Almost everything on the menu is good, but the Carnitas and all the seafood dishes stand out. Don't forget to check the Chef's Specials board as you walk in. They don't have a hard liquor license but still manage to make a pretty mean ""margarita"" from a potent Mexican wine. The salsa's a bit weak (canned tomatoes) but definitely forgiveable in light of all the other great food.
